Google simply isn’t working for a lot of people, who’ve been turned away by too-full testing centers and empty shelves. So people attempting to track down COVID-19 tests have found an unlikely “solution:” turning to video game console restock experts, who have begun tracking COVID-19 testing kits alongside Microsoft, Sony, and Nintendo hardware. Current-generation consoles like the Xbox Series X and PlayStation 5 have been in short supply since they launched in 2020, creating a culture of console tracking; Twitter users tracking restocks have gained massive audiences across social media platforms, simply by informing folks when consoles are in stock. The bleak scarcity of COVID-19 tests and the difficulty in acquiring them, echoes the culture of console tracking — but on a much more urgent need, caused by the country’s infrastructure failures.
